  • Dec 8, 2012
    Keith Urban receives the Harmony Award from the Nashville Symphony at the Schermerhorn Symphony Center
    Dec 8, 2011
    Keyboard player Dick Sims dies of cancer. He worked with Eric Clapton during the 1970s, playing on Clapton's lone country hit, "Lay Down Sally"
    Dec 8, 2011
    Doctors remove 70% of Wade Hayes' liver and over 20 inches of his large intestine during surgery for stage IV colon cancer at the Vanderbilt Medical Center in Nashville
    Dec 8, 2011
    Bass player Dan "Bee" Spears dies of exposure after falling outside his Nashville home. During 40 years with Willie Nelson's band, Spears contributed to such hits as "Whiskey River," "Georgia On My Mind" and "Blue Eyes Crying In The Rain"
    Dec 8, 2011
    K.T. Oslin and Mike Reid play a Toys For Tots benefit at Belmont University in Nashville with songwriters Don Schlitz, Lisa Carver and Shane McAnally
    Dec 8, 2011
    Chris Cagle sings the national anthem before an NFL game at Heinz Field in Pittsburgh. The Steelers ground the Cleveland Browns, 14-3
    Dec 8, 2011
    The Lynyrd Skynyrd BBQ & Beer has its grand opening at the Excalibur Hotel in Las Vegas. The band plays "Sweet Home Alabama" for a crowd that includes baseball player Jose Canseco and jazz trumpeter Arturo Sandoval
    Dec 8, 2010
    "Seven Spanish Angels" singer Ray Charles places #22 among Gibson.com's 50 Most Revolutionary Artists. Following him in the Top 30: James Brown, #23; Madonna, #26; and Little Richard, #28
    Dec 8, 2010
    Big Show Music publishes "Homecoming, The Diffie Family Cookbook," written by Joe and Flora Diffie
    Dec 8, 2010
    Cover Girl announces Taylor Swift will be a spokesperson for the cosmetics company

    RolandNote.com is a detailed country music database compiled by veteran music journalist Tom Roland that chronicles more than 60,000 events and 10,000 recordings.

     

    Discover what happened in country music on a particular date or in a particular month, get the history of your favorite country songs or your favorite country artists.
